在SELECT查询上,我似乎得到了一个“不可能的地方”。我在下面发布了两个查询,它们在子查询中有不同之处。这些查询所做的是在更新计数之前,检查用户是否已经保存了一次。我使用SELECT进行测试,但实际查询将使用UPDATE:WHERE id = 2343243AND ( FROM posts as p
WHERE p.pos
在对每个表执行一些操作之后,我需要将多个表合并成一个表。第一次嵌套是通过(工作) "WITH“声明实现的:T1 as (Select col1, col2, col3,...where *condition*)
From(d.col1, d.col2, d.col3,...where *conditions* on t
我只是在编写一个复杂的更新查询,该查询大致如下所示: (select y, min(x) as MinX groupby y) as t1set x = x - MinX
这意味着变量x是基于子查询更新的,该查询还处理变量x --但是不能通过运行的update命令修改吗?我正在使用MySQL,但答案也适用于其他PostgresQL、Oracle等,特别是用于标准的。谢谢!